Once a miner has verified 1 MB (megabyte) worth of Bitcoin transactions, they are entitled to win the 12.5 BTC. The 1 MB limit was set by Satoshi Nakamoto, and is an issue of controversy, as some miners think the block size should be increased to accommodate more data.

Note that I stated that verifying 1 MB worth of transactions makes a miner qualified to earn Bitcoin--not everyone who verifies transactions will get paid off.

1MB of transactions can theoretically be as little as 1 transaction (though this is not in any way common) or several thousand. It depends on how much information the transactions consume.

Example: I tell three friends that I'm thinking of a number between 1 and 100, and that I write that number on a sheet of paper and seal it in an envelope. My friends don't have to guess the exact number, they simply must be the very first person to figure any number that is less than or equal to the number I am thinking of.

What Does Bitcoin Mining Code Do?


Let us say I am thinking of the number 19. If Friend A guesses 21, they lose because 21>19. If Friend B supposes 16 and Friend C guesses 12, then they have both technically came at workable answers, because 16<19 and this website 12<19. There is no"extra credit" for Friend B, even though B's answer was nearer to the target answer of 19. .

In Bitcoin terms, simultaneous answers This Site occur frequently, but at the end of the day there can only be one winning answer. When multiple simultaneous answers are presented which can be equal to or less than the target number, the Bitcoin network will determine by a simple majority--51 percent --which miner to honour. Now imagine I pose the"guess what number I'm thinking of" question, however I am not asking only three friends, and I'm not thinking of a number between 1 and 100. Rather, I am asking millions of prospective miners and I'm thinking of a 64-digit hexadecimal number. Now you see that it is going to be quite difficult to guess the right answer.
